As nouns, butterflower is a hypernym of Ranunculus repens; that is, butterflower is a word with a broader meaning than Ranunculus repens:
  • Ranunculus repens: perennial European herb with long creeping stolons
  • butterflower: any of various plants of the genus Ranunculus
Other hypernyms of Ranunculus repens include butter-flower, buttercup, crowfoot, goldcup, kingcup.
